Real-Time Anomaly Detection in CCTV Surveillance

A deep learning system that watches surveillance footage and automatically flags threatening activity — theft, violence, and property damage — in real time.


What It Does

RealtimeSurviellance.mp4

Most CCTV systems record everything but catch nothing until a human reviews the footage after the fact. This project flips that — a model watches the stream live, classifies what's happening every few frames, and overlays the result directly on the video.

Four output classes:

  • normal — no incident
  • theft — shoplifting, robbery, burglary
  • violence — assault, fighting, abuse
  • property_damage — arson, vandalism

Architecture

Video Frame
    │
    ▼
CLAHE contrast enhancement          ← improves visibility in dark CCTV footage
    │
    ▼
YOLOv8 person detection + crop      ← focuses the model on people, not background
    │
    ▼
Top-16 motion frame selection       ← picks the most action-rich frames from a 64-frame buffer
    │
    ▼
ResNet50 feature extraction         ← pretrained CNN, outputs 2048-dim vector per frame
    │
    ▼
BiLSTM classifier                   ← learns temporal patterns across the 16-frame sequence
    │
    ▼
4-class prediction + smoothing      ← rolling window reduces single-frame flicker

The same preprocessing pipeline runs identically during training and live inference, so the model never sees a different distribution at runtime.


Results

Evaluated on a held-out stratified test split (15% of dataset).

Class Precision Recall F1
normal 0.9518 0.9130 0.9320
theft 0.8955 0.9104 0.9029
violence 0.8530 0.9028 0.8772
property_damage 0.8889 0.8889 0.8889

Test Accuracy : 90.72%

Tech Stack

Role Tool
Person detection YOLOv8n (Ultralytics)
Feature extraction ResNet50 (Keras, ImageNet)
Temporal model Bidirectional LSTM (TensorFlow)
Video decoding Decord
Frame processing OpenCV
Motion scoring PyTorch

Dataset

UCF Crime Dataset — real-world CCTV footage across 13 anomaly categories, consolidated into 4 classes for this project. Class imbalance is handled through per-class window oversampling and weighted loss during training.
